If you know any college that you highly recommend let me know! The courses are around the same difficulty or slightly more challenging at UT. GPA wise, UTSA is more lenient. The standard cutoff for an A is a 90 here. At UT Austin, the standard cutoff for an A is a 93. A 90-93 is considered as an A-. 90-94 = A. 87-89 = A-. 85-87 = B+. 80-85 = B. 77-79 = B-. etc... Keep in mind that many of the tough classes grade on a curve and you don't always have the opportunity to compare letter grades to the 0-100 scale. I've had a few professors distribute grades based on how everyone did comparatively. UTSA limits the number of cap students on their campus and you have less than 30 seconds to get a spot there from when the portal opens on the appointed day.
